Build a life-sized statue of Diogo Jota at Anfield

The Issue

Diogo Jota wasn’t just a football player — he was a spark of life, a source of joy, and a fighter who carried the spirit of Liverpool FC every time he stepped on the pitch. His sudden and heartbreaking death has left fans across the world in mourning. This petition is not just about honoring a player — it’s about preserving the legacy of a man who gave everything to the game, and to us.

I still remember watching Jota score on his Premier League debut for Liverpool against Arsenal. That moment was electric — the way he ran, the emotion in his face. You could feel that he wasn’t just playing football — he was living it. He connected with fans in a way that can’t be taught or coached. His journey from a promising young player in Portugal to becoming a key figure at Anfield was a testament to his talent, humility, and relentless work ethic.

In his time at Liverpool, Jota scored 41 goals in 110 appearances, delivering crucial goals in high-stakes matches and helping the team stay competitive in both domestic and international competitions. But statistics only tell part of the story. Jota was beloved not just for what he did, but for how he did it — with heart, integrity, and a smile that could light up Anfield.

He was known for his versatility, able to play across the front line with equal threat. Whether coming off the bench or starting big games, he always gave 100%. He brought calm under pressure, flair in attack, and a selfless attitude that made him a favorite among teammates and supporters alike. His goals brought hope. His presence brought unity.

For many young fans, Jota was the player they wanted to be. For older fans, he was a reminder of what football used to be about: love for the game, respect for the club, and giving your all without ego. His tragic passing at such a young age has left us all shocked and grieving. We’ve lost more than an athlete — we’ve lost a friend, a role model, a legend in the making.

That is why we are calling on Liverpool Football Club to honor Diogo Jota’s life and contribution by building a life-sized statue at Anfield Stadium. This wouldn’t just be a monument. It would be a place where fans can come to grieve, remember, and celebrate everything he meant to us. It would be a symbol for future generations — a reminder of the kind of player and person Diogo Jota was.

Statues at Anfield are rare and reserved for the truly great. But Diogo Jota, in his short time, gave us more than many do in entire careers. He gave us memories, inspiration, and a sense of belonging. This is our chance to make sure that legacy is never forgotten.
